This recipe needs advance preparation!
A chocolate cake marbled with pink and white marshmallows.
Ingredients
Printable 🖨 shopping 🛒 list & 👩🍳 method for this recipe
- 350g Green & Black's dark chocolate, broken into small pieces
- 250g butter
- 1½ tablespoons water
- 1½ tablespoons caster sugar
- 1½ teaspoons vanilla extract
- 1½ tablespoons orange juice
- 3 medium egg yolks, whisked lightly and strained
- 125g digestive biscuits, one half crushed and one half roughly chopped
- 175g pink and white marshmallows, cut into halves and quarters
- 1 tablespoon cocoa powder mixed with 1 tablespoon chocolate powder
Method
- Melt the chocolate with the butter, water and sugar in a mixing bowl set over a pan of hot water taken of the heat.
- Stir until smooth, then remove the bowl from the heat and leave to cool a little.
- Lightly whisk in the vanilla and orange juice, followed by the egg yolks.
- Mix the digestive biscuits with the chocolate mixture, followed by the marshmallows.
- Pour into a lightly butter 20cm round tin, lined with greaseproof paper.
- If necessary, press the mixture down and level off with a palette knife.
- Cover with cling film and refrigerate overnight.
- Turn out onto a plate and dust the top with the cocoa powder mixture.
- Cut into wedges while still chilled and keep in the fridge until required.
